Total Student Population Comparison

The total student population of selected colleges is 8,198 with 4,612 female students and 3,586 male students. This enrollment stat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023. The following table compares the student population for both undergraduate and graduate schools between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Grand View University has the most enrolled students of 1,827, while Allen College has the least number of students of 497 for both in graduate and undergraduate programs.
Student Population Comparison Between Selected Colleges
NameTotalMenWomen
Allen College 49757 440
Coe College 1,264554 710
Grand View University 1,827802 1,025
Luther College 1,610727 883
Des Moines University-Osteopathic Medical Center 1,527706 821
William Penn University 1,473740 733
Total8,198 3,5864,612

Undergraduate Student Population

The total undergraduate population of selected colleges is 6,112 with 3,397 female students and 2,715 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 undergradu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Luther College has the most enrolled undergraduate students of 1,610, while Allen College has the least number of undergraduate students of 278.
Undergraduate Student Population Comparison Between Selected Colleges
NameTotalMenWomen
Allen College 27825 253
Coe College 1,264554 710
Grand View University 1,556715 841
Luther College 1,610727 883
William Penn University 1,404694 710
Total6,1122,7153,397

Graduate Student Population

The total graduate population of selected colleges is 2,086 with 1,215 female students and 871 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 gradu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Des Moines University-Osteopathic Medical Center has the most enrolled graduate students of 1,527, while William Penn University has the least number of graduate students of 69.
Graduate Student Population Comparison Between Selected Colleges
NameTotalMenWomen
Allen College 21932 187
Grand View University 27187 184
Des Moines University-Osteopathic Medical Center 1,527706 821
William Penn University 6946 23
Total2,0868711,215
